article.php in PHP FirstPost 0.1 allows allows remote attackers to obtain the full pathname of the server via an invalid post number in the post parameter, which leaks the pathname in an error message.

CVE-2002-0445 is an information leak in PHP FirstPost 0.1. A malformed article request can cause the application to reveal the server’s full filesystem path in an error message. This is usually not business-critical by itself, but it can help attackers map infrastructure for later attacks. Exposure is limited to environments still running PHP FirstPost 0.1. Internet-facing legacy PHP deployments are the main concern. Modern systems are unlikely to be affected unless this old application remains installed or archived on a reachable web server. Treat this as low urgency unless PHP FirstPost 0.1 is still publicly reachable. If found, remove or isolate it because unsupported legacy software often carries broader risk than this single path disclosure. Mitigation focus: Identify and remove any remaining PHP FirstPost 0.1 deployments.; Check vendor or project guidance for any historical patch or replacement advice.; Disable detailed PHP error display in production environments..
